
A sexy, rock star, marriage of convenience romance by New York Times bestselling author K. Bromberg.
Jase Gizmodo is the wild card of the world-famous band BENT. He drums like a legend, lives like a rebel, and attracts headlines like a magnet. But when his recklessness causes a no-nonsense judge to threaten the band’s upcoming international tour, he needs a quick fix—and proof that he’s settling down might just do the trick.
Enter Hendrix Wright. Cookie queen. Small business owner. And barely hanging on. Her dream bakery is on the brink of closing its doors thanks to her ex’s betrayal, and she needs a miracle. Who knew a chance meeting with a charming, enigmatic, and incredibly sexy stranger in a coffee shop would change all that?
So when that stranger, Jase, offers her a deal—a temporary marriage for the cameras in exchange for the money to save her bakery—Hendrix should run. Fast. But instead, she finds that the more time they spend faking wedded bliss, the more real their chemistry feels.
Because falling for a rockstar was never part of the plan.
But surrendering? That might be the sweetest risk of all.

About K. Bromberg
New York Times bestselling author K. Bromberg writes contemporary romance novels that contain a mixture of sweet, emotional, a whole lot of sexy, and a little bit of real. She likes to write strong heroines and damaged heroes who we love to hate but can’t help to love.
A mom of three, she plots her novels in between school runs and soccer practices, more often than not with her laptop in tow and her mind scattered in too many different directions.
Since publishing her first book on a whim in 2013, Kristy has sold over one and a half million copies of her books across eighteen different countries and has landed on the New York Times, USA Today, and Wall Street Journal Bestsellers lists over thirty times. Her Driven trilogy (Driven, Fueled, and Crashed) is currently being adapted for film by the streaming platform, Passionflix, with the first movie (Driven) out now.
